Seasonal Tips: Winter and Summer Maintenance Considerations
When it comes to security system maintenance Pittsburgh PA, understanding seasonal tips can help ensure optimal protection year-round. During the winter months, it’s essential to prepare your security system for colder temperatures and potential snow accumulation. This includes checking outdoor cameras for any signs of damage from ice or snow, inspecting wiring for exposure, and ensuring all components are securely fastened to prevent frost or wind damage. A professional technician can also perform a thorough inspection, identifying potential vulnerabilities and making necessary adjustments.
In the summer, focus on proactive measures to protect against heat-related issues. High temperatures can affect battery life in security cameras, so regular checks and replacements are crucial. Additionally, summer storms bring an increased risk of power outages, so testing backup batteries and ensuring reliable power sources for your security camera systems and security camera installation is vital. Leveraging cloud-managed security solutions offers remote monitoring capabilities, enabling you to stay informed about any issues and remotely address them if needed, even during these seasonal transitions.
